The Problem with Managing Channels Separately

Many organizations still rely on a multichannel approach where each communication channel operates in isolation. While this method allows businesses to be present on multiple platforms, it often leads to disconnected conversations and repeated customer queries. Customers frequently have to explain their issues multiple times when switching from one channel to another, which results in frustration and loss of trust.

This limitation highlights the core issue in the debate of multichannel vs omnichannel support. Multichannel support focuses on presence, whereas omnichannel support focuses on experience. Without a unified customer support system, agents lack the context needed to provide meaningful assistance, leading to slower resolution times and inconsistent service quality.

What Is an Omnichannel CX Platform?

An Omnichannel CX platform is a centralized system that integrates all customer communication channels—such as email, live chat, social media, messaging apps, and voice—into a single interface. This ensures that every customer interaction is connected, regardless of the channel used, allowing businesses to deliver a seamless and cohesive experience.

Unlike a traditional omnichannel communication platform, a modern Omnichannel CX platform goes beyond just integration. It combines data, automation, and intelligence to provide a complete view of the customer journey. This unified approach enables support teams to understand customer history, preferences, and behavior, allowing them to respond with greater accuracy and personalization.

The Role of AI in Modern Customer Support

AI-powered customer support is transforming how businesses handle customer interactions. By integrating artificial intelligence into an Omnichannel CX platform, companies can automate repetitive tasks, analyze customer intent, and provide instant responses without compromising quality.

AI tools such as chatbots, virtual assistants, and intelligent routing systems help reduce response times and improve efficiency. These systems can handle common queries, suggest relevant solutions to agents, and even predict customer needs based on previous interactions. This not only enhances productivity but also ensures that customers receive timely and relevant support across all channels.
